Q1: What is the measurement range of the Dwyer Series-2000-Magnehelic Differential Pressure Gauge?
A1: The Dwyer Series-2000-Magnehelic Differential Pressure Gauge measures pressure differences in the range of 0 to 500 pascals (Pa).
Q2: What applications is the Dwyer Series-2000-Magnehelic suitable for?
A2: This differential pressure gauge is ideal for monitoring clean room environments, HVAC systems, filter status, and air flow in duct systems.
Q3: How does the Series-2000-Magnehelic gauge indicate differential pressure?
A3: The gauge uses a Magnehelic design, which employs a precision diaphragm and magnetic coupling to provide accurate and reliable pressure readings on an easy-to-read dial.
